首页 | 本学科首页   官方微博 | 高级检索  
     检索      

AORM持久层框架的设计与实现
引用本文:李春梅.AORM持久层框架的设计与实现[J].安庆师范学院学报(自然科学版),2015(1):71-75.
作者姓名:李春梅
作者单位:安徽新华学院信息工程学院,安徽合肥,230088
摘    要:针对传统ORM(object-relational mapping)框架使用成本高、执行效率难以控制等缺点,结合软件开发过程中的实际要求,提出了AORM(adaptive object-relational mapping)持久层框架的设计方案。该方案以C#的反射机制为基础,综合考虑软件实际开发过程中的具体要求,结合多种数据库类型的语法特点,建立了以XML关系映射文件与自适应关系映射相结合的AORM持久层框架。与传统ORM框架相比,其最大的特点是将SQL语句独立于应用程序,非常有利于数据库结构的调整和优化。

关 键 词:AORM  ORM  对象关系映射  多种数据库类型  数据持久化

Design and Implementation of AORM Persistence Layer Framework
LI Chun-mei.Design and Implementation of AORM Persistence Layer Framework[J].Journal of Anqing Teachers College(Natural Science Edition),2015(1):71-75.
Authors:LI Chun-mei
Institution:LI Chun-mei;School of Information Engineering,Anhui Xinhua University;
Abstract:Aiming at the disadvantages of traditional ORM(object-relational mapping) framework such as high cost and difficult to control, combined with the actual process of software development requirements, a AORM (adaptive object-relational mapping) persist-ence framework was proposed.This framework is based on the reflection mechanism in C#, considering the specific requirements at actual software development process, combined with the grammatical features of multiple database types, established the persistence framework, which integrates the XML-relation mapping files and auto-relational mapping method.Compared with the traditional ORM framework, the application-independent SQL statements is the biggest feature, and very beneficial to adjust and optimize the database structure.
Keywords:AORM  ORM  object-relational mapping  multiple database types  data persistence
本文献已被 CNKI 万方数据 等数据库收录!
设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号